Mark Malloch Brown, Baron Malloch-Brown
Summary
Mark Malloch Brown, Baron Malloch-Brown is a human[1]. His place of birth was Marylebone[2]. He was born on September 16, 1953[3]. He worked as a politician[4], journalist[5], and businessperson[6].
